Disregarding the Surrounding Atmosphere



When selecting exterior paint colors, many organizations ignore the importance of their surrounding atmosphere, which can cause dissimilar aesthetics and shed opportunities. You may find a vibrant color appealing in isolation, however if it clashes with nearby frameworks or the all-natural landscape, it can develop an inhospitable atmosphere.

Think about the architectural design of neighboring structures and the general ambiance of your location. If you remain in a seaside neighborhood, soft blues and sandy beiges may reverberate much better than vibrant reds or deep greens. Also, metropolitan setups usually favor streamlined, modern-day schemes that align with the bordering facilities.

Take time to analyze the colors controling your community. This does not suggest you can not reveal your brand name's personality, yet it should harmonize with its environment. You want to attract customers, not repel them with rough contrasts.

Incorporating components like regional plants can also improve your layout, creating a smooth change in between your business and its environments.

Overlooking Color Psychology



Disregarding the bordering atmosphere can lead to dissimilar visual appeals, yet that's simply one part of the equation. You can't neglect color psychology when selecting exterior paint colors for your company. Colors stimulate emotions and can considerably affect how prospective consumers view your brand. For instance, blue typically conveys trust fund and professionalism and reliability, while red can ignite passion and urgency.

Consider your target audience and the sensations you wish to evoke. If your company is family-oriented, cozy colors like yellows and oranges can create a welcoming environment. Conversely, if you're going for a smooth, modern ambiance, cool tones like grey or navy may be more appropriate.

Do not neglect that shades can additionally impact presence and stand out. Brighter shades can stand out in a jampacked environment, making your organization extra recognizable. Nevertheless, choose wisely; overly intense colors could overwhelm or prevent customers, depending on your industry.



Ensure to evaluate paint examples in various illumination problems to see just how they communicate with the setting and your message.

Missing Test Samples



While it could seem alluring to skip the examination examples when choosing outside paint colors, doing so can result in unexpected results. You might assume you have actually picked the ideal color based on a small example or a digital sneak peek, however colors can look considerably various relying on lighting and surroundings.

What appears like a vibrant blue in the store may show up dull or washed out on your building. To avoid this error, constantly check your picked colors on the actual surface area. Purchase small sample pots and use patches on different locations of your exterior.

Observe exactly how the color modifications throughout the day as the light shifts. This easy action can save you from a pricey repaint later on. Additionally, consider the colors of surrounding buildings and landscape design. These components can affect exactly how your color choice looks in the broader context.

Do not fail to remember to take note of the coating-- matte, satin, or glossy-- because it additionally affects the total appearance. Investing time in screening examples ensures you're not just satisfied with the shade yet likewise certain it boosts your organization's visual charm.
